java中如何理解抽象属性(abstract)

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 20:36:11
java中如何理解抽象属性(abstract)

java中如何理解抽象属性(abstract)
java中如何理解抽象属性(abstract)

java中如何理解抽象属性(abstract)
abstract修饰的方法,是让他的子类实现的,自身不做实现.这样就好像定义了一个模版,你也可以把它想象为一道填空题.比如你在做一个银行系统的时候,要你写一个算利息的程序.而对于利息(本金*利率)中利率的值,根据存款年限的不同,资金的不同,存款方式的不同,利率就不同,所以你没办法,写一个具体的方法来算利率.所以你只能定义一个抽象方法来表示利率,而自身不去实现.根据不同的情况,在子类中实现你的抽象方法,算出利率.